Areas of Collaboration

MACRO is dedicated to fostering strong relationships between Hawai‘i’s military and civilian communities by addressing shared challenges and opportunities. Explore how MACRO is working to build a sustainable and connected future through these areas of collaboration.

Through transparent and open communication, MACRO builds bridges between local communities and military installations, addressing concerns that range from cultural access to emergency preparedness. By facilitating dialogues on issues such as land use and access to military sites for cultural practices, MACRO strives to create an atmosphere of mutual respect and cooperation.

MACRO is committed to identifying opportunities for mutual benefit, with projects that serve the interests of both military and civilian communities. This approach not only promotes mutual appreciation but also creates real, practical benefits for all involved. By working closely with local agencies, MACRO enhances community infrastructure, public safety, and economic opportunities, enriching the lives of Hawai‘i residents and military personnel alike.

Through the Hawai‘i Defense Alliance (HDA), MACRO promotes business and workforce development in Hawai‘i’s defense sector, supporting local businesses and creating job opportunities within the community. MACRO is also conducting economic impact studies to assess the broader effects of military spending, ensuring that the economic contributions of the defense sector are well-understood and that strategies are in place to maximize benefits for Hawai‘i’s economy.

This DOD-funded initiative aims to rebuild and renovate public schools that serve both military and civilian families. By partnering with the Hawai‘i Department of Education, MACRO will help to ensure that educational facilities around military installations are well-equipped to meet the needs of all students, fostering a more inclusive and supportive learning environment.
